Understanding Hydrangea Macrophylla Colors: The Science Behind the Spectacle
The ability of many Hydrangea macrophylla varieties to change color is one of their most enchanting features. It’s not magic, though it certainly feels like it! This phenomenon is all thanks to a fascinating chemical reaction happening right beneath the soil surface.
The Magic of Soil pH and Aluminum
The primary driver behind the blues and pinks of your bigleaf hydrangeas is the presence of aluminum ions in the soil and the soil’s pH level. Think of pH as a scale from 0 (very acidic) to 14 (very alkaline), with 7 being neutral.
- Acidic Soil (pH below 6.0): When your soil is acidic, aluminum becomes readily available to the plant. The hydrangea absorbs this aluminum, which then reacts within the petals to produce stunning blue flowers.
- Alkaline Soil (pH above 7.0): In alkaline conditions, aluminum is “locked up” in the soil and less accessible to the plant. Without sufficient aluminum uptake, the flowers will naturally turn pink.
- Neutral Soil (pH 6.0-7.0): If your soil is in the neutral range, you might see a beautiful mix of pink and blue, or even lovely lavender and purple tones. This is because some aluminum is available, but not enough for a pure blue.
It’s a delicate balance, and understanding this relationship is your first step to mastering your desired Hydrangea macrophylla colors.
Not All Hydrangeas Change Color
Before you start amending your soil, it’s crucial to know that not all hydrangeas participate in this color-changing game. Only the “bigleaf” hydrangeas (Hydrangea macrophylla) and some Hydrangea serrata varieties have this ability.
White-flowering hydrangeas, like the popular ‘Annabelle’ (a Hydrangea arborescens) or ‘Limelight’ (a Hydrangea paniculata), will always remain white or creamy white, regardless of soil pH. They don’t contain the necessary pigments or the ability to absorb aluminum in the same way. So, always confirm your hydrangea variety before attempting a color shift!
How to Influence Your Hydrangea Macrophylla Colors for Stunning Blooms
Now for the fun part! Once you know the science, you can start actively working to achieve those dream shades. Remember, patience is key, and results aren’t always immediate. It can take a season or two for the changes to fully manifest.
Cultivating Vibrant Blue Hydrangeas
If you’re aiming for those breathtaking true blue blooms, you need to make your soil more acidic and ensure aluminum is present. This is a common goal for many gardeners, and it’s quite achievable!
- Test Your Soil: Start with a soil test. You can buy a simple kit at your local garden center or send a sample to your cooperative extension office for a more detailed analysis. This tells you your current pH.
- Add Aluminum Sulfate: This is your go-to product for blueing hydrangeas. Mix 1 tablespoon of aluminum sulfate per gallon of water and apply it around the base of the plant every 2-4 weeks during the growing season. Always water your plant thoroughly first to prevent root burn.
- Incorporate Acidic Organic Matter: Peat moss, pine needles, or oak leaves can help lower soil pH over time. Work them into the soil around the drip line of your plant.
- Use Acid-Forming Fertilizers: Choose fertilizers with a higher nitrogen and potassium content and lower phosphorus (e.g., a 25-5-30 ratio). Look for products specifically labeled for “acid-loving plants” or “blue hydrangeas.”
- Avoid Phosphorus: High phosphorus levels can bind with aluminum, making it unavailable to the plant, even in acidic soil.
Be careful not to over-apply aluminum sulfate, as too much can damage the plant. Start gradually and monitor your results. A pH between 5.0 and 5.5 is ideal for intense blues.
Nurturing Rich Pink Hydrangeas
To encourage pink blooms, you need to raise your soil’s pH, making it more alkaline, and limit the plant’s access to aluminum. This is often easier in areas with naturally alkaline soil.
- Test Your Soil: Again, start with a soil test to determine your current pH.
- Add Garden Lime: Granulated garden lime (calcium carbonate) is the most common way to raise soil pH. Follow package directions carefully, as too much can harm the plant. Generally, apply in the fall or early spring.
- Incorporate Alkaline Organic Matter: Hardwood ash (from untreated wood) can also help raise pH, but use sparingly.
- Use Low-Acid Fertilizers: Opt for fertilizers with a higher phosphorus content (e.g., a 10-20-10 ratio) and lower nitrogen and potassium. These are often labeled for “flowering plants” or “pink hydrangeas.”
- Avoid Aluminum: If you have naturally acidic soil, avoid adding aluminum sulfate or acidic amendments.
For vibrant pinks, aim for a soil pH between 6.5 and 7.0. It’s important to remember that significant pH changes take time and consistent application.
Achieving Captivating Purple Shades
Purple hydrangeas are often a happy medium, a beautiful blend of blue and pink. This happens when the soil pH is in the slightly acidic to neutral range (around 6.0-6.5), meaning there’s some, but not excessive, aluminum available to the plant.
If you have blue hydrangeas and want purple, slightly raise the pH by adding a small amount of garden lime. If you have pink hydrangeas and want purple, slightly lower the pH with a touch of aluminum sulfate or acidic organic matter. It’s a delicate dance to find that perfect balance!
White Hydrangeas: A Special Case
Many Hydrangea macrophylla varieties begin their bloom cycle with white or creamy white flowers that then transition to pink or blue, depending on the soil. However, some cultivars, like ‘Madame Emile Mouillère’, are genetically predisposed to stay white throughout their bloom, sometimes with a slight blush as they age.
If you specifically desire pure white blooms from a bigleaf variety, you’ll typically need to choose a cultivar known for its stable white color. Remember, soil amendments won’t turn a blue or pink hydrangea white, only influence its blue/pink/purple spectrum.
Essential Care Tips for Maintaining Desired Hydrangea Shades
Achieving the right hydrangea macrophylla colors isn’t just about pH; it’s also about overall plant health. A happy, healthy hydrangea is more likely to give you the vibrant blooms you desire.
Watering and Fertilizing for Color Consistency
Consistent watering is crucial, especially during dry spells. Hydrangeas are thirsty plants, and wilting can stress them, potentially impacting bloom quality and color. Aim for deep, regular watering, particularly in the morning, to allow foliage to dry before nightfall.
When it comes to fertilizing, less is often more. Over-fertilizing can lead to lush foliage but fewer flowers. Use a balanced slow-release fertilizer in early spring, and then follow up with your color-specific amendments. Always apply fertilizers according to package directions, and avoid fertilizing late in the season, as this can encourage new growth that is vulnerable to frost.
Pruning for Health and Bloom Production
Most Hydrangea macrophylla varieties bloom on “old wood” (stems from the previous year). Prune these types right after they finish flowering in summer. This gives the plant time to set new buds for the following year.
Only remove dead, damaged, or weak stems. Avoid heavy pruning, as you might cut off next year’s blooms! Newer “reblooming” or “everblooming” varieties bloom on both old and new wood, offering more flexibility in pruning time, usually in late winter or early spring.
Protecting Your Hydrangeas from Environmental Stress
Hydrangeas prefer a location with morning sun and afternoon shade, especially in hotter climates. Too much intense sun can scorch the leaves and fade the flowers. In colder zones (USDA Zone 5 and below), provide winter protection by mulching heavily around the base or wrapping the plant to protect those precious old wood buds from harsh freezes.
Good air circulation is also important to prevent fungal diseases. Ensure your plants aren’t too crowded. When faced with extreme weather, like a sudden cold snap or prolonged drought, providing extra care can mean the difference between lackluster blooms and a spectacular display.
Common Challenges and Troubleshooting Your Hydrangea Macrophylla Colors
Even with the best intentions, you might encounter some bumps on your journey to perfect hydrangea colors. Don’t worry, these issues are often easily resolved!
When Colors Don’t Shift as Expected
If your blue isn’t blue enough, or your pink isn’t vibrant, here are a few things to consider:
- Soil pH Check: Did you re-test your soil after amending? pH changes can be slow.
- Aluminum Availability: In some soils, aluminum may be naturally low. Ensure you’re consistently applying aluminum sulfate for blue.
- Phosphorus Levels: High phosphorus in your soil or fertilizer can block aluminum uptake. Switch to a low-phosphorus fertilizer.
- Water Quality: If you have very hard water (high in calcium), it can counteract your efforts to acidify the soil. Consider using rainwater for blue hydrangeas.
- Plant Age: Very young plants or those recently transplanted might take longer to show significant color changes.
Remember, some varieties are simply more difficult to shift than others due to their genetic makeup. A true, deep blue is often harder to achieve in naturally alkaline soils.
Addressing Nutrient Deficiencies and Pests
Healthy foliage is essential for vibrant blooms. Yellowing leaves (chlorosis) can indicate an iron deficiency, which is more common in alkaline soils. An iron chelate supplement can help, especially for blue hydrangeas.
Keep an eye out for common pests like aphids or spider mites, and diseases like powdery mildew. Address these issues promptly with appropriate organic or chemical controls to keep your plant vigorous and focused on producing those beautiful blooms.
Designing with Color: Incorporating Hydrangea Macrophylla in Your Landscape
Once you’ve mastered influencing your hydrangea macrophylla colors, you can use them to create stunning garden compositions. Their large, showy blooms make them excellent focal points or mass plantings.
Pairing Hydrangeas with Companion Plants
Consider the color wheel when choosing companion plants. For blue hydrangeas, think about plants with yellow or orange flowers for a complementary pop, or silver foliage for a cool, harmonious look. Pink hydrangeas pair beautifully with purples, whites, or even deep reds.
Good companion plants should also share similar light and soil preferences. Ferns, hostas, astilbes, and impatiens are excellent choices, providing texture and color that thrive in similar part-shade conditions.
Creating Stunning Container Displays
Hydrangeas are fantastic in containers, especially if your garden soil isn’t ideal for your desired color. Growing them in pots gives you complete control over the potting mix and pH. Use a high-quality potting mix and amend it as needed with aluminum sulfate or lime for your desired color.
Container hydrangeas will need more frequent watering and feeding than those in the ground, as nutrients leach out faster. Ensure your pots have excellent drainage to prevent waterlogging.
Frequently Asked Questions About Hydrangea Macrophylla Colors
How long does it take for hydrangea colors to change?
Color changes can take time. You might see a subtle shift in the first season, but it often takes a full growing season or two of consistent soil amendments for the color to fully develop and stabilize. New blooms will show the change first.
Can I change the color of a white hydrangea?
No, white Hydrangea macrophylla varieties, or other white species like Hydrangea paniculata or Hydrangea arborescens, cannot have their color changed to blue or pink. Their genetics prevent the necessary pigment and aluminum interaction.
Will coffee grounds make my hydrangeas blue?
While coffee grounds are acidic and can help lower soil pH slightly over time, they don’t provide the aluminum necessary for blue blooms. You’ll still need to add aluminum sulfate for true blue colors, but coffee grounds can contribute to maintaining acidity.
Why are my hydrangeas multi-colored on the same plant?
Multi-colored blooms on a single plant usually indicate uneven soil pH around the root ball. Perhaps one side of the plant is getting more aluminum or is in a pocket of more acidic soil than the other. It can also happen when a plant is transitioning from one color to another.
When is the best time to apply soil amendments for color?
The best time to start applying soil amendments for color is in early spring, just as the plant is breaking dormancy and beginning its active growth cycle. This allows the plant to absorb the necessary elements as it develops its flower buds. Continue applications every 2-4 weeks throughout the growing season, stopping in late summer to allow the plant to prepare for winter.
